Aperistalsis

/ˌæpɛrɪˈstælsɪs/ noun

The absence or failure of peristalsis, the muscular contractions that move food through the digestive tract.

From Greek 'a-' (without) + 'peristalsis' (wave-like motion). Medical term describing a digestive dysfunction.
